“Oh, no,” Cody interrupted. “Kim.” She pulled her onto her lap and into a fierce embrace. After a few seconds, she leaned back just enough to meet and hold her gaze. Hers was literally burning now, in sharp contrast to her earlier reaction. “Hey, this is the best gift.”
“Are you sure?”
“Hundred percent! Kim, there’s nothing I want more than to be with you all the time. This feels right to me too.”
“But you went white.”
“Did I?”
“Uh-huh.”
Cody flashed a sweet, open smile.
“Now you’re showing your observant and tenacious lawyer side, Ms. Reed.” She laughed and gave a light shrug. “I don’t know why I paled... Surprise, probably.”
Relaxing, Kim caressed her cheek with a folded knuckle.
“Did you think I was proposing to you?”
“No.” Cody’s blue eyes sparkled. “Maybe.” She flushed. “I don’t know, perhaps on some level, yes... I saw the box, and my mind went blank. You have to admit it looked a bit suspicious, right?”
“Suspicious, huh?” Kim frowned again, jokingly this time. “What? Like a grenade?”
“Not quite as lethal as that.” Still amused, Cody kissed her on the lips. She traced a soft finger over her mouth. “I mean, you could have just handed me the keys, eh?”
“I could have.” Kim shrugged. “Didn’t.”
“No…” Cody’s expression grew tender, tentative, and eager all at the same time. “Makes me wonder if maybe, on some level, you meant to present them to me as a bit more than just a living arrangement.”
“Now you’re showing your shrewd and clever cop side.” Kim mirrored her earlier words and statement. “What if it were a little bit more?” she prompted. ”On some level, maybe? How would it make you feel?”
Cody kept her eyes fixed on her face. She answered easily, pretty much instantly. “It would make me feel great. I love you, Kim. I am in love with you. You know it, right?”
For sure, they had danced around that a lot… But of all the ways she might have told her, for the very first time, this hit the deepest and strongest with Kim. Perhaps because her tone was so calm, quiet, and sure. So undramatic, but also charged with undeniable feeling and truth.
“Don’t cry,” Cody added in a whisper.
“Ah!” Kim blinked back tears. “It’s just... God, Cody!”
She kissed her long and deep, full of the joy she felt. Cody was grinning from ear to ear when she let go. Happy and a little dazed. Gorgeously so. When she looked up, her eyes were a bit wet as well. Kim cupped her face in both hands.
“I love you too.” She blew air out sharply. “Wow.”
“Yes, it is,” Cody chuckled. “Totally wow.”
“I don’t know what else to say.”
“Then shut up and kiss me again.”
Kim laughed. Yeah, she was right. Anything else, any more words, could well wait. She tasted clean heat on her lips as she resumed the kiss. She felt her emotion in the way Cody kissed her back. And as she held her, so gentle, and even with a touch of reverence, yet firm and self-assured at the same time. Like Kim belonged to her. Cody did not protest when she slid off her lap and offered her a hand, she just nodded once and rose eagerly to follow. Dinner could wait too.
